Just find out. And remember that weather plays alot in ET's, so running with the same air temps and humidity will make for a better comparison. And it usually takes more than one trip to the track with a new combo to run the best times.

well i gotta say nitrous bob seems to know his shyt ! first run down the track was a 14.55 and i was pretty pissed. lowered the psi to what i thought was 15 psi and best pass i made was 14.36 at 94 mph. Turned out that my air pressure gauge was messed up i tried my friends expensive one half way into my bracket racing and it turned out i was running at 24psi and not 18 like i thought . So when i was running "15" i would have actually been running close to 20. But no excuses because it seemed the lower the psi i went the slower i went after half track. My car didnt have enough power to push it but i kind of wish i lowered it down to a real 12psi and seen what happend. i was in the middle of my bracket racing and didnt want to wreck my consistancy.
